Hilbert Saturday Softball Game Moved to Sunday
April 20, 2012
HAMBURG, NY - The Allegheny Mountain Collegiate Conference softball game between Hilbert and Pitt-Greensburg originally scheduled for Saturday, April 21 has been rescheduled to Sunday, April 22, still in Hamburg.

Baseball Game Date Changed; Softball Game Cancelled
April 19, 2012
The softball game originally scheduled for Friday, April 20 at Morrisville has been cancelled. Morrisvillie had to  reschedule a league game which takes priority over the non-conference game against the Hawks . No make up date will be set.
